14 October (Part 2) - Panel beating

Police panelsThis extract from the Conservative’s latest by-election leaflet attracted the attention of a long term Police Panel Member. He says that the Panels already exist in every ward and asks why Christine Bishop doesn’t know.

Police panelsThe Panels work alongside the separate Neighbourhood Watch organisation to help the police determine what their priorities should be.

The quarterly meeting sets three objectives, one chosen by the police and two more from Panel Members.

Why didn’t Christine Bishop know that Panels are an existing thing or is it a simple promise easily fulfilled? A bit like Bexley Tories claiming to have fulfilled every Manifesto promise since 2006.

Unfortunately a search of the Belvedere ward police website does not reveal anything interesting. Maybe the Belvedere Panel has gone AWOL and there is a job for Christine to do after all?
